Unlock the Full Potential of HappyFiles: Comprehensive Documentation Guide You Can't Miss!
Introduction
In today's digital age, managing files and data efficiently is crucial for businesses to maintain their competitive edge. HappyFiles, a robust file management solution, offers a plethora of features designed to streamline file organization, access, and collaboration. This comprehensive documentation guide will delve into the intricacies of HappyFiles, exploring its capabilities, best practices, and how to maximize its potential. By the end of this guide, you will have a thorough understanding of HappyFiles, ensuring that your organization can unlock its full potential.
HappyFiles: An Overview
HappyFiles is an innovative file management platform designed to cater to the needs of individuals and businesses alike. It provides a secure and centralized solution for storing, sharing, and managing files, regardless of their size or format. With HappyFiles, organizations can enhance productivity, improve collaboration, and ensure data security.
Key Features
- Intuitive Interface: HappyFiles boasts an intuitive interface that makes navigating and managing files a breeze.
- Cloud Storage: Securely store files in the cloud, ensuring that they are accessible from anywhere, at any time.
- File Sharing: Share files with colleagues or clients with ease, complete with access control and versioning.
- Collaboration Tools: Collaborate on files in real-time, with support for multiple users and concurrent editing.
- Document Management: Track changes, maintain version control, and easily recover previous versions of files.
- Mobile Access: Access your files on the go, using HappyFiles' mobile app for iOS and Android devices.
HappyFiles API Gateway
HappyFiles also integrates with an API gateway, providing a seamless experience for users who rely on third-party applications to interact with their files. This integration ensures that your files can be accessed and manipulated through various APIs, enhancing the overall flexibility of HappyFiles.
API Gateway: What It Is and How It Works
An API gateway is a single entry point for all API requests, acting as a facade for backend services. It provides a centralized way to manage, authenticate, and route API calls. By using an API gateway, organizations can benefit from the following:
- Security: Protect your backend services with robust security measures, such as authentication, authorization, and rate limiting.
- Reliability: Ensure high availability and fault tolerance by routing requests to multiple backend services.
- Monitoring: Monitor API usage and performance, enabling you to identify and resolve issues quickly.
- Flexibility: Simplify the process of adding new services and APIs, making it easier to scale your application.
APIPark: An Open Platform for API Management
One of the most popular API gateways is APIPark, an open-source AI gateway and API management platform. APIPark offers a wide range of features, including:
- Quick Integration of 100+ AI Models: Integrate AI models with your backend services, enabling advanced functionalities such as image recognition, natural language processing, and more.
- Unified API Format for AI Invocation: Ensure seamless interaction between your services and AI models, regardless of the model or prompt.
- Prompt Encapsulation into REST API: Create custom APIs that leverage AI models and prompts, simplifying the process of adding advanced functionalities to your application.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πππ
Integrating HappyFiles with APIPark
Integrating HappyFiles with APIPark can be done in several steps:
- Set up HappyFiles: Ensure that HappyFiles is properly configured and accessible.
- Configure APIPark: Create a new API gateway in APIPark, and configure the necessary authentication and routing rules.
- Connect HappyFiles to APIPark: Use the HappyFiles API to interact with your files through APIPark.
- Test and Monitor: Verify that the integration works as expected and monitor the API performance.
Example Scenario
Imagine a scenario where you want to allow users to upload files to HappyFiles using a third-party application. By integrating HappyFiles with APIPark, you can achieve this by following these steps:
- Create an API in HappyFiles: Set up a new API that allows users to upload files to HappyFiles.
- Configure APIPark: Define the necessary authentication and routing rules for the API.
- Connect APIPark to the Third-Party Application: Use the HappyFiles API in the third-party application to upload files to HappyFiles.
Best Practices for Using HappyFiles
To maximize the benefits of HappyFiles, it is essential to follow these best practices:
- Regularly Backup Your Files: Ensure that your files are backed up regularly to prevent data loss.
- Use Access Controls: Limit access to sensitive files by setting appropriate permissions.
- Utilize Collaboration Tools: Leverage collaboration tools to enhance teamwork and productivity.
- Train Your Team: Educate your team on the best practices for using HappyFiles.
Table: HappyFiles vs. Other File Management Solutions
| Feature | HappyFiles | Other Solutions |
|---|---|---|
| Security | High | Moderate |
| Collaboration | Excellent | Good |
| Mobile Access | Excellent | Moderate |
| Integration | Excellent | Good |
| User Experience | Excellent | Good |
Conclusion
HappyFiles is a powerful file management solution that can significantly enhance your organization's productivity and collaboration. By following this comprehensive documentation guide, you will have a solid understanding of HappyFiles and how to maximize its potential. Additionally, integrating HappyFiles with an API gateway like APIPark can further enhance its capabilities, allowing you to create a seamless and secure file management ecosystem.
FAQ
Q1: Can HappyFiles be accessed via mobile devices? A1: Yes, HappyFiles offers a mobile app for both iOS and Android devices, allowing users to access their files on the go.
Q2: Is HappyFiles secure? A2: Yes, HappyFiles employs robust security measures, including encryption and access controls, to ensure the safety of your files.
Q3: Can I integrate HappyFiles with third-party applications? A3: Yes, HappyFiles can be integrated with third-party applications through its API gateway, such as APIPark.
Q4: How can I backup my files in HappyFiles? A4: HappyFiles automatically backs up your files. Additionally, you can manually create backups using the platform's built-in tools.
Q5: What is the difference between HappyFiles and other file management solutions? A5: HappyFiles stands out for its user-friendly interface, advanced collaboration features, and seamless integration with third-party applications, making it an excellent choice for organizations of all sizes.
πYou can securely and efficiently call the OpenAI API on APIPark in just two steps:
Step 1: Deploy the APIPark AI gateway in 5 minutes.
AP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.
cur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

Step 2: Call the OpenAI API.
